Output 5d64aeaa029c09eaf411c43934f78614bb32ec9570e808fe9c9312ae5c6f8dbe:25

value
1585482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12148d75a54b1c94e10a0d782ad27b7509f2ee2c OP_EQUAL
address
33Lci1orDb47VLmMS4JcrS1XPsGvsETGa7
transaction
5d64aeaa029c09eaf411c43934f78614bb32ec9570e808fe9c9312ae5c6f8dbe